Key details about DUI Metropolitan Services, Inc.

How long is treatment?

Minimal Risk - 10 hours of DUI Risk Education
Moderate Risk - 10 hours of DUI Risk Education & 12 hours of Early Intervention
Significant Risk - 10 hours of DUI Risk Education & 20 hours of treatment + aftercare
High Risk - 75 hours of treatment + aftercare

How long is treatment?

DUI Program Minimal Risk: 10 hours of DUI Risk Education
DUI Program Moderate Risk: 10 hours of DUI Risk Education and a minimum of 12 hours of early intervention
DUI Program Significant Risk: 10 hours of DUI Risk Education and a minimum of 20 hours of substance abuse treatment
DUI Program High Risk: 75 hours of substance abuse treatment minimum

New Vision Withdrawal Management, Thorek Memorial Hospital location, in Chicago, Illinois, offers detox for adults. After examining the website, we found that adult patients can access a hospital-based medical detox center. It specializes in opioids, benzodiazepines, alcohol, and other drugs. Patients must be experiencing impending or active withdrawal.
